Find Answers to Your Questions

Explore millions of answers from experts and enthusiasts.

How can autoencoders contribute to transfer learning?

Autoencoders are neural network architectures that learn to compress and reconstruct input data, effectively capturing essential features of the dataset. Their role in transfer learning is significant, as they provide a robust way to extract meaningful representations, especially in cases where labeled data is scarce.

In transfer learning, a pre-trained model is adapted for a different, yet related task. Autoencoders can be used to pre-train a neural network on an extensive dataset, where they learn to encode information efficiently. This pre-training phase allows the model to capture intrinsic properties of the data, which can then be fine-tuned for specific downstream tasks.

By using the encoder part of the autoencoder as a feature extractor, the learned latent space can serve as a starting point for various applications like classification, clustering, or anomaly detection. Additionally, this approach reduces the risk of overfitting when only limited labeled data is available for the target task.

Overall, autoencoders enhance transfer learning by enabling effective data representation, facilitating the sharing of knowledge across tasks, and improving model performance in scenarios with limited training data.

Similar Questions:

How can autoencoders contribute to transfer learning?
View Answer
How does transfer learning contribute to reinforcement learning in games?
View Answer
How to deal with negative transfer in transfer learning?
View Answer
How does transfer learning apply to reinforcement learning?
View Answer
How do you implement transfer learning in reinforcement learning scenarios?
View Answer
What are the best practices for transfer learning in deep learning?
View Answer